Abstract

Machinery is described for strapping lengthy rectangular goods. Wooden trusses (6-9) are placed around and against the piece to be packed (4). These are produced by a fully automatic unit (10) from any length of material (3). The machine (12) adds surrounding strapping (11). A further, rising and falling strapping unit (15), forms a binding (13) for the trussing (6, 7, 8). The order of strapping may be reversed. Strapping positions (16) on the packaged pieces (4), and dimensions of the trussing sections made by the unit (10), are determined using data stored in memory.

In the known strapping packaging, the strapped wood falls apart after the removal of the packaging straps, so that the goods also fall apart if they are not stack-stable. This leads to damage to the goods and injuries to people who have to open the packaging tapes in order to be able to remove the goods from the package.
These disadvantages have so far been partially attempted to be solved by placing a connecting band around the two vertical wooden strips at the middle height of the packages during the process of loading the goods into a transport trolley in which the wooden strips are manually inserted according to their end positions on the package after opening the all-round strapping it holds together until the connecting strap must also be loosened in order to be able to remove the goods from the package completely. With such a process of producing a package, all processes for the ready-to-ship production of the package, such as inserting the packaging tapes, wood and the goods into the frame and attaching the connecting tape, placing the upper timber on the package and tensioning and closing the packaging tapes take place where the goods are made.
Because of the large amount of manual handling, automation of the production of the packages ready for dispatch is not possible and would also have to be carried out on every goods manufacturing machine. This is wasteful and therefore uneconomical.

After the all-round strapping 11 of the packages 4, the woods 7 and 8 are additionally provided on the wood 6 with connecting straps 13. This connection strapping 13 has the important task of holding on to the wood 7 and 8 on the wood 6 at the point of use until the goods 2 have been completely removed from the package 4.
A strapping device 15, which can be raised and lowered with drives 14, is provided for producing the connection strapping 13.
After this process, the packages 4 which are now ready for transport are removed from the transport vehicle 1 with automatic lifting devices and placed as a unit ready for dispatch.
